About the Property

Forde Apartments is a modern student-focused community located at 4231 12th Ave NE, placing students in the heart of the lively U-District. Offering practical 2B and 4B floor plans, the property is designed for students who want privacy, convenience, and easy access to top universities. With the University of Washington just 8 minutes away by car and Seattle Pacific University 12 minutes away by car, it’s a go-to choice for those seeking comfortable and reliable student apartments in Seattle. The community also receives consistently positive mentions in Forde Apartments reviews, especially for its straightforward living experience and ideal U-District location.

Location and What's Hot?

Forde Apartments Seattle benefits from its prime U-District address, placing residents near some of the most iconic and student-loved locations in Seattle. Students are also placed close to establishments like North Seattle College and Cornish College of the Arts . It’s a bustling stretch filled with favorites like Sweet Alchemy Ice Creamery, Memos Mexican Food, Chatime, Shultzy’s Sausage, U:Don Fresh Japanese Noodle Station, and Monsoon Tea Shop. These spots are popular with University of Washington students for meals, study breaks, and late-night cravings.

For coffee lovers, nearby cafés such as Café Solstice, Ugly Mug Café, Café Allegro, and Elm Coffee Roasters offer cozy spaces perfect for classes, remote work, and group projects. Students can also access essential stores easily with Target, Trader Joe’s, Safeway, and Whole Foods Market, all within minutes. Entertainment hubs like Neptune Theatre, Varsity Theatre, and Burke Museum of Natural History & Culture add cultural depth to the neighborhood.

Outdoor enthusiasts can explore scenic spots like Union Bay Natural Area, Ravenna Park, Green Lake Park, and the waterfront paths along Portage Bay, all ideal for jogging, biking, or relaxing between study sessions. The area’s walkability and proximity to bus lines and light rail significantly reduce transportation costs, which is especially beneficial given the rising cost of living in Seattle.

The U-District is also home to academic resources such as the UW Libraries, the Husky Union Building (HUB), and major campus landmarks, making the neighborhood both vibrant and academically supportive. With its central location, abundance of food spots, cultural venues, and student-friendly energy, Forde Seattle places residents in one of the most dynamic neighborhoods for student housing in Washington.

Commute

The nearest major transit point is the U District Light Rail Station, located approximately 0.6 miles from Forde Apartments Seattle. This provides fast access to Downtown Seattle, Capitol Hill, Roosevelt, and other key areas. Multiple bus stops are also spread along University Way NE and 12th Ave NE, with the closest stop just 0.1 miles from the property, making daily commuting to the University of Washington or around the city convenient and efficient.
